I personally don't own such hardware, and I never have userd cryptsetup's keyscript support. So I'm probably not the most qualified to evaluate the situation. That said, reading the upstream discussion, I guess we have 3 options a/ do nothing about it b/ apply the patch from David Härdeman downstream and maintaining it as a downstream patch forever c/ try to implement keyscript support based on the PasswordAgent interface a/ is obviously not very compelling. As for b/, we try to avoid downstream patches as much as possible. Regarding c/, I dunno how much effort that would be. Bringing David into the loop here.
